 * I have tried to code my own theme but I got nowhere, so I’m using a HEAVILY modified
   version of Binary News by Herreman David. I have it working pretty much as I 
   want now except for the following niggles:
 * – Link headers in the sidebar can’t seem to be changed. They’re huge. I want 
   them to be the same style as the post headers but I can’t figure out how to do
   this.
    – Links are all bulleted – I wish to remove the bullets, but again, I 
   simply cannot figure out how. – The “posted on date by author” text also cannot
   be changed somehow. I’d like that to be slightly smaller and light gray but cannot
   manage this.
 * I think it’s because there are no identifying tags there (ie. use h1 or h2 here,
   etc), but I don’t know where I should alter that.

 * I would look at the sidebar.php and the main index php (or wherevere the post
   are displayed). Look to see what css tag is around the item you are concerned
   with. Then look in the stylesheet for that tag and change it.
 * If you are using FF, you could turn on view css and then click on the section
   you are interested in. That will show you the css and then you can start modifying
   it.
